Bruce D. White, MS, CFP®

CREATING AND PRESERVING WEALTH THROUGH FINANCIAL PLANNING

Bruce D. White, MS, CFP® has provided financial planning and investment advisory services since 1984. He holds a B.A. in Economics and an M.S. in Financial Planning and earned the Certified Financial Planner™ designation. He is also a member of the Financial Planning Association (FPA) and the Institute of Certified Financial Planners (ICFP), professional organizations dedicated to advancing the standards and ethics of the financial planning profession.

As Principal of PB White & Co., a Registered Investment Advisor based in San Luis Obispo, California, Bruce leads a team of experienced professionals who work collaboratively to serve clients with consistency and care. The firm is structured to provide thoughtful planning, disciplined investment oversight, and responsive client service. Together, Bruce and his team support individuals and families seeking long-term guidance across financial planning, retirement planning, and investment strategy.

His planning philosophy centers on two disciplines essential to financial independence: building wealth through consistent saving and disciplined investing to preserve wealth by addressing the risks that can erode it over time, including inflation, taxes, healthcare costs, and major life transitions. 

Through a structured and methodical process, Bruce helps clients clarify priorities, evaluate alternatives, and align investment strategies with their time horizon, cash flow needs, and tolerance for risk. Recommendations are designed to be clear, diversified, and practical, emphasizing realistic expectations and long-term consistency rather than unnecessary complexity or short-term market movement.

Sample Financial Planning Reports & Deliverables

When working with PB White & Co., you will receive structured reports designed to organize your financial information, evaluate your current position, and guide future decisions.

These documents provide clarity around cash flow, investments, retirement projections, and tax considerations, forming the foundation of our ongoing planning discussions.

Cash Flow Evaluation
A detailed overview of your assets, liabilities, income, and expenses that establishes the foundation for planning recommendations.
Retirement Capital Sufficiency Analysis
A forward-looking projection that evaluates whether your current savings and investment strategy support your retirement goals.
Financial Snapshot Summary
A high-level summary of your net worth, account structure, and key financial metrics.
Tax-Adjusted Cash Flow Analysis
A review of income, expenses, and tax impact to support more efficient financial planning decisions.
Scenario Modeling & Planning Report
A dynamic planning tool used to test different financial scenarios and evaluate potential outcomes before decisions are made.
